Counseling Services

CLASSROOM MODULES

Counselors reach out to all students by teaching lessons, or modules, in classrooms throughout the year. Topics, such as study skills, social skills, organization, and time management are discussed at all grade levels.

TEAM MEETING PARTICIPATION

Counselors meet with all teams regularly to discuss student needs and team concerns. 

SMALL GROUP SESSIONS

These thematic groups address student needs as they arise and may include topics such as divorce, loss, and peer pressure.

STUDENT ASSISTANCE PROGRAM

The Student Assistance Program seeks to identify emotional problems early so that interventions may be initiated. Short-term counseling is provided to assess a student's strengths and concerns. An extensive list of professional resources for outside referrals is available. Crisis intervention is also provided. Parents may call the Counseling Office if they have a concern about their child and wish to speak to the Student Assistance Counselor.
